The Orlando Magic invade the Moda Center to take on the Portland Trailblazers on Tuesday night.

The Orlando Magic have been doing it tough lately as they’ve lost 13 of their last 16 games and they will be hoping to bounce back after getting routed by the Bulls in a 118-92 home loss on Saturday. Nikola Vucevic led the team with 17 points and eight rebounds, Dwayne Bacon added 16 points while Mo Bamba chipped in with 14 points and three blocks on seven of eight shooting off the bench. As a team, the Magic shot just 38 percent from the field and six of 27 from the 3-point line as they fell behind by 18 points at halftime after scoring just 12 points in the second quarter, before getting blown out in the third quarter where they trailed by as many as 33 points. 

Meanwhile, the Portland Trailblazers have been in decent form lately as they’ve split their last eight games and they will be hoping to get back in the win column after getting dropped by the Knicks in a 110-99 road loss on Saturday. Damian Lillard led the team with 29 points and nine assists on 10 of 20 shooting, Gary Trent Jr. added 19 points while Enes Kanter and Robert Covington each scored 13 points. As a team, the Trailblazers shot just 41 percent from the field and 17 of 47 from the 3-point line as they set the tone with 31 points in the first quarter, before getting outplayed the rest of the way as they never found their rhythm after scoring just 20 points in the second quarter. Carmelo Anthony had a night to forget as he finished with just two points on one of eight shooting while Rodney Hood scored just seven points on three of 10 shooting.
